Carol
Amos
May 6, 1955 — May 3, 2024
Carol Amos, 68, of Ellsworth went to be with her Lord and Savior on Friday, May 3, 2024. She was born May 6, 1955 in New Eagle, daughter of the late Louis and Flora (Kitty) Amos. As well as being devoted to her family, she was a lifelong member of the Bentleyville United Methodist Church and a member of the United Women in Faith, and a 1973 graduate of Bentworth High School.
Surviving are two sons, Shane Wilson of Russell Springs Kentucky, and Gideon Wilson of Ellsworth, Grandsons Jaden Wilson, Kian Wilson and Liam Wilson, Granddaughter Harvest Moon, Brother Lou Amos (Jeannette), Sisters Connie Harris, Cathy Meredith (Ed), Cyndi Colley (Paul), Aunt Janet Shriner, Uncle Joe Lucy along with many cousins, nieces and nephews, and many dear friends.
Deceased in addition to her parents are a sister Bonnie Lynn Amos, her twin son Gabriel Wilson, son Jadie Wilson, a brother Lorne (Mark) Amos, cousin Daniel Hess and two Brother in laws, Earl Harris and Greg Gehringer.
Carol lived a vibrant life, was very kind hearted, and loved her Lord and Savior, family and friends unconditionally. She was a hard worker, dedicating herself to many jobs to raise her boys. Carol put everyone first before ever thinking of herself. She never met a stranger that she didn't take under her wing.
Funeral services are private. A 'Celebration of Life' service will be held at a later date to be announced. Arrangements are entrusted to Greenlee Funeral Home, 619 Main St. Bentleyville, PA.
